Tyre Management Analysis
In Formula 1, tyre management is crucial for success. It involves balancing speed and tyre degradation. Degradation is the wear and tear on tyres, which can slow a car down. Max Verstappen and Sergio Perez both started on medium tyres, but Verstappen managed his tyres better. From laps 2 to 16, Verstappen's tyres degraded at 141 milliseconds per lap, while Perez's tyres wore down at a faster rate of 180 milliseconds per lap. This suggests Verstappen was gentler on his tyres, preserving their performance longer.
The story shifted slightly in the next stint. From laps 17 to 34, Perez improved his tyre management. His degradation dropped to just 4 milliseconds per lap, compared to Verstappen's 46 milliseconds per lap. This change indicates Perez adjusted his driving style to conserve his tyres better. However, Verstappen's early advantage meant he still had the upper hand overall.
In the final stint on hard tyres, Verstappen again showed superior tyre management. His degradation was only 17 milliseconds per lap, while Perez's was 22 milliseconds per lap. This consistent management allowed Verstappen to maintain a competitive pace throughout the race. Good tyre management means a driver can push harder when needed, while others might struggle with worn tyres. Verstappen's ability to manage his tyres effectively gave him a strategic edge, allowing him to maintain speed and control in the race.

Race Classification
| Pos | Driver | Team | Grid | Gap | Pts |
|---|---|---|---|---|---|
| 1 | Verstappen | Red Bull Racing | 1 | — | 26 |
| 2 | Perez | Red Bull Racing | 2 | +12.535s | 18 |
| 3 | Sainz | Ferrari | 4 | +20.866s | 15 |
| 4 | Leclerc | Ferrari | 8 | +26.522s | 12 |
| 5 | Norris | McLaren | 3 | +29.7s | 10 |
| 6 | Alonso | Aston Martin | 5 | +44.272s | 8 |
| 7 | Russell | Mercedes | 9 | +45.951s | 6 |
| 8 | Piastri | McLaren | 6 | +47.525s | 4 |
| 9 | Hamilton | Mercedes | 7 | +48.626s | 2 |
| 10 | Tsunoda | RB | 10 | +1.601s | 1 |
| 11 | Hulkenberg | Haas F1 Team | 12 | +7.168s | 0 |
| 12 | Stroll | Aston Martin | 16 | +11.233s | 0 |
| 13 | Magnussen | Haas F1 Team | 18 | +17.919s | 0 |
| 14 | Bottas | Kick Sauber | 13 | +18.893s | 0 |
| 15 | Ocon | Alpine | 15 | +41.152s | 0 |
| 16 | Gasly | Alpine | 17 | +55.066s | 0 |
| 17 | Sargeant | Williams | 19 | +72.765s | 0 |
| 18 | Zhou | Kick Sauber | 20 | — | 0 |
| 19 | Ricciardo | RB | 11 | — | 0 |
| 20 | Albon | Williams | 14 | — | 0 |
